AggressivelyStupid posted:Kevin Love for White LeBron, who says no? I know you're mostly joking but unless Lebron wants to defend the 4 full time and Favors is ok being perma benched, you'd need to expand it. That JR Smith deal is such an albatross, if it was shorter you might be able to throw him and picks in to get Favors and let Utah kick their cap space down the line to a further year. But he's making 15 million in 18-19 and a partially guaranteed 20 million in 19-20. I don't think Cleveland has the assets to move that deal without making the team worse in the short term.

FIBA 3 x 3 tournament rules: http://www.fiba.com/documents/2016/01/29/3x3%20Rules%20of%20the%20game%202016%20table.pdf 3 players + 1 sub (can sub at any deadball) Half court Score 1s and 2s First to 21 or whoever is leading after 10 minutes 12 second shot clock Take it out beyond the arc on a rebound Defence gets ball on made basket 1s and 2s mean Kyrie and Curry would absolutely kill in this.
